Sat 173419128860385

decimal
34683.4128860385
degree
0°34683′411″4128860385‴
percentile
8.258053764340291%
name
mpurukpptbk
cycle
0
epoch
0
period
17
block
34683
offset
4128860385
timestamp
rarity
common